Watford is 10 or so miles,from Aldbury Nick Ashby Sharon Starkey wrote: >Would anyone have knowledge of the family of Walter ASHBY (b. 1843 at Aldbury, Herts) who was a farmer of 500+ acres at Studham from about 1875? His wife was Eliza BAILEY (b.1846 at Studham, d.1899 Studham). They were married at Studham October 17, 1871. > >Children of Walter and Eliza Ashby were: > Gertrude J. Ashby, b. 1873 Aldbury > William Henry Ashby, b 1875 Aldbury > Florence Lizzie Ashby, b. 1879 Studham, Herts > John Ashby, b. 1880 Studham > Thomas Ashby, 1883 Studham > Annie Ashby, 1884 Studham > Marion Ashby, 1886 Studham > Daisy Ashby, 1889 Studham > >Florence Lizzie Ashby married Frank Thomas King in 1906 at St. Mary the Virgin parish church at Oxford University. In 1912 they emigrated to Canada. Florence died in Alberta, Canada in 1938. Florence Ashby and Frank King were my grandparents. > >I have no knowedge of the members of the family of Florence Ashby aside from the above vital statistics, and I would be very interested to know anything about her family. > > >Thankyou for any information. > >Sharon Starkey, nee King >Vancouver Island, BC, Canada > > >==== ENG-HERTFORDSHIRE Mailing List ==== >For any updates our info about the status of this list go to >http://helpdesk.rootsweb.com > > > > > >
